| SECTION 11 - TOXICOLOGICAL PROPERTIES |
|-------------------------------------------------------------------------|
CASRN Chemical Name LD50 LC50
67-64-1 Acetone - Rat:50100 mg/m3/8H
9004-34-6 Cellulose Oral Rat:>5 gm/kg Rat:>5800mg/m3/4H
123-86-4 n-Butyl acetate Rat:10768 MG/KG Rat:2000 PPM
9004-70-0 Cellulose nitrate Oral Rat:>5 gm/kg
67-63-0 Isopropyl alcohol Rat:5045 mg/kg Rat:16000 ppm/8H

| SECTION 13 - DISPOSAL CONSIDERATIONS |
|-------------------------------------------------------------------------|
WASTE MANAGEMENT/DISPOSAL: Recycle or incinerate at an EPA approved
facility or dispose in compliance with Federal, State, and local
regulations. Do not reuse empty containers. State and Local
regulations/restrictions are complex and may differ from Federal
regulations. Responsibility for proper waste disposal is with the owner of
the waste.
EPA WASTE CODE - If discarded (40 CFR 261): None, yields no liquid
component when evaluated by EPA method 1311 (TCLP)

| SECTION 14 - TRANSPORTATION INFORMATION |
|-------------------------------------------------------------------------|
DOT PROPER SHIPPING NAME: Flammable Liquid, N.O.S. (Contains acetone)
(Consumer Commodity*)
DOT HAZARD CLASS: 3(ORM-D*)
DOT UN/NA NUMBER: UN 1993(NONE*) PACKING GROUP: III(NONE*)
* For containers of 1 gallon or less
NOTE: the shipping information provided is applicable for domestic ground
transport only. Different categorization may apply if shipped via other
modes of transportation and / or non-
domestic transport.
